John Wick Video Game Announced: Keanu Reeves’ Action Franchise Expands

by Lisa Park - Tech Editor

Lionsgate is expanding the John Wick universe beyond the silver screen with a new AAA video game, developed by Saber Interactive. The announcement, made during Sony’s State of Play Showcase on , signals a significant push by the studio into the gaming market, leveraging the popularity of its action franchise.

The game, a third-person action title, is slated for release on P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X|S, and PC. Lionsgate is positioning this as a mature-audience experience, aiming to replicate the visceral action and intricate world-building that have become hallmarks of the John Wick films. Saber Interactive, known for its work on titles like Warhammer 40,000: Space Marine 2, is tasked with bringing that vision to life.

The project isn’t simply a licensed adaptation. it’s described as a collaborative effort involving key creative figures from the film franchise. Chad Stahelski, director of all four John Wick movies, and Keanu Reeves, the star himself, are both actively involved in the game’s production. Reeves is confirmed to reprise his role, contributing his likeness and voice to the game. This level of involvement suggests a commitment to maintaining the authenticity of the John Wick experience.

Jenefer Brown, President of Global Products & Experiences at Lionsgate, emphasized the collaborative nature of the project. “We are collaborating closely with Saber’s dedicated team to develop a game that captures the unparalleled action, brand-defining fight choreography, immersive world-building, and authenticity of the films,” she stated. Matthew Karch, CEO of Saber Interactive, echoed this sentiment, calling John Wick “one of the most iconic characters in action film history” and expressing his team’s honor in working alongside Stahelski, Reeves, and Lionsgate.

The game’s narrative will be set within the established John Wick timeline, but will unfold “years before the Impossible Task,” according to Saber Interactive. This positioning allows the game to expand upon the existing lore of the franchise, introducing both familiar faces and new characters. The developers are aiming to contribute to the broader understanding of the High Table and the complex rules governing the assassin underworld.

A key focus for Saber Interactive is faithfully recreating the signature “gun-fu” combat style that defines the John Wick films. Jesus Iglesias, the game’s director, explained that the team is developing a “distinct combat system from the ground up” to ensure the gameplay feels like an authentic extension of the movie experience. This suggests a departure from simply adapting existing game mechanics and a commitment to building a system specifically tailored to the demands of John Wick’s action choreography.

Lionsgate’s interest in gaming extends beyond John Wick. During a recent earnings call, Adam Fogelson, Chairman of Lionsgate, revealed plans to explore gaming opportunities around other franchises, including Saw. This indicates a broader strategic shift towards interactive entertainment as a means of expanding the reach and revenue potential of its intellectual property. The studio sees significant potential in the premium gaming market and is actively seeking to establish a stronger presence within it.

The success of the John Wick franchise – with four films grossing over $1 billion collectively – has fueled this expansion. The films revitalized Keanu Reeves’ career and established Stahelski and David Leitch as prominent action directors. Despite the apparent death of John Wick in Chapter 4, a fifth film is already in development, alongside a spinoff centered on Caine, played by Donnie Yen, demonstrating the continued momentum of the franchise.

The announcement of the John Wick game comes as Lionsgate continues to build out its television offerings, including a spinoff series, The Continental, and a forthcoming film, Ballerina. This multi-platform approach underscores the studio’s commitment to maximizing the value of the John Wick universe and catering to a diverse range of fan preferences.
